Output 806a669ded1c89c24b910e93c00c94b4e433393e9d4549a900a6929180941502:5

value
20637300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 981da90dea899eccfd8fb8a4c7fddbde3b08cb97 OP_EQUAL
address
MMmUURiWr5f8za3u5wWCZWSVS81rNnwFAP
transaction
806a669ded1c89c24b910e93c00c94b4e433393e9d4549a900a6929180941502
spent
true